Generate Manim code directly from the user's description. Follow this procedure:

Step 1: Parse the math intent

  • Identify the math topic (linear/quadratic/trig/geometry/etc.)
  • Extract any explicit functions mentioned
  • Determine what should be animated (parameter changes, comparisons, constructions)
  • Decide appropriate axes range

Step 2: Generate Manim Python code

Write a complete, self-contained Manim script following these rules:

  1. Start with from manim import * and import numpy as np
  2. Create ONE Scene subclass with a descriptive name
  3. Use Axes or NumberPlane for function visualizations
  4. Use ValueTracker + always_redraw for dynamic parameter animations
  5. Use Text("中文", font="Noto Sans CJK SC") for Chinese labels
  6. Use MathTex(r"y = kx + b") for math formulas
  7. Keep total duration 5–30 seconds
  8. Add a Chinese title at the top with Text

Code structure template:

from manim import *
import numpy as np

class [TopicName]Scene(Scene):
    def construct(self):
        # 1. Title
        title = Text("[中文标题]", font="Noto Sans CJK SC", font_size=32).to_edge(UP)
        self.play(Write(title))

        # 2. Axes
        axes = Axes(x_range=[...], y_range=[...], axis_config={"include_numbers": True})
        self.play(Create(axes))

        # 3. Function graph (static or dynamic)
        # For dynamic: use ValueTracker + always_redraw
        # For static: use axes.plot()

        # 4. Annotations (dots, labels, lines)

        # 5. Animations (parameter changes, transforms)

        # 6. Final wait
        self.wait(1)

Step 3: Validate the code

Before rendering, validate with:

python scripts/render_manim.py --validate-only <<< "$CODE"

This checks:

  • Syntax correctness (AST parse)
  • No forbidden imports (os, subprocess, socket, etc.)
  • Scene subclass exists
  • from manim import * present

Step 4: Render to video

python scripts/render_manim.py --scene [ClassName] --quality medium --format mp4 <<< "$CODE"

Or from file:

python scripts/render_manim.py --file scene.py --scene [ClassName] -q medium

Output is JSON:

{"success": true, "video_path": "/tmp/manim_output_xxx/...", "duration_seconds": 8.5}

Step 5: Deliver

  • Return the video file to the user
  • Show the generated code (optional, for transparency)
  • Display the reasoning/title

Common Math Animation Patterns

For detailed Manim API reference and ready-to-use patterns, see references/manim-params.md. Key patterns:

  • Linear function (一次函数): Axes + ValueTracker for k and b + always_redraw graph
  • Quadratic function (二次函数): Parabola + vertex dot + axis of symmetry + animate a/b/c
  • Trigonometric (三角函数): Extended x_range with PI steps + sin/cos comparison
  • Geometry (几何): Polygon + Dot vertices + angle marks + transformations

Safety (Math Animation)

  • Only manim and numpy imports allowed
  • No filesystem/network/system access in generated code
  • Render timeout: 120 seconds max
  • Code length limit: 50,000 characters
